The 7th Annual Kensington Market Jazz Festival Announces Return October 1 and 2, 2022

0

The annual Kensington Market Jazz Festival (KMJF) will return to in-person entertainment Oct. 1-2 in Toronto’s vibrant neighbourhood of art, vintage shops and multicultural cuisine, a designated National Historic Site of Canada.

Created and helmed by award-winning jazz vocalist Molly Johnson, KMJF will kick off at Tom’s Place (190 Baldwin St), the hub of the festival’s solo piano series, hosted by Holly Nimmons. The other participating venues include Tapestry (formerly Poetry Jazz Café), Handlebar, Supermarket and Pamenar with seven shows each per day. There are also Pay-What-You-Can shows in Bellevue Square Park on Saturday and Sunday from 1-2:30pm and 4-5:30pm.

The weekend concerts run from 1 p.m. until 11 p.m.

There are no advance tickets. All shows will operate in the traditional KMJF format of ‘Audience Pays Artist,’ – Cash Only – where the trusted KMJF volunteers collect a cover charge at the door. For full transparency, KMJF takes a 10% service charge to go towards festival production and the remaining 90% is given to the band leader. This format works for all as KMJF has a track record of filling venues through word-of-mouth, and extensive promotion through the festival themselves and artists working together. 100% of the proceeds from CD sales during KMJF go directly to the artist.

The Kensington Market Jazz Festival is a Charitable organization, committed to presenting live music in the heart of Toronto’s heritage market neighbourhoood throughout the year and with a festival in early fall.

Trend-Setting Celtic Punks The Mahones Announce New Album ‘Jameson Street’ Out Oct 7

0

Jameson Street – set for worldwide release on October 7, 2022 via True North Records, is like a guided tour down a cobblestone road in Dublin delivering a record packed with “positivity and good vibes”.

Jameson Street is meant to make you feel like you’re having a night out,” frontman Finny McConnell explains. “No politics, no religion, just good times, and everybody having fun. Unity is the underlying message.”

For this fun-loving group of musicians, there are few things better than loving, drinking, fighting, and a splash of hope to get them through the day. It is no surprise that these are the elements fueling the songs on Jameson Street – with shanties harking on good times and comradery – and a little bit of tin whistle and fiddle for good measure. The song “Holloway Jack” is a perfect example of what it means to be in the Mahones. The song features lyrics by the late Paddy Cuncanon, a long-time friend of the band, sending their friend off with a pint and good cheer.

The Mahones’ brand of Celtic-Punk energy is on full display on the group’s drinking pub jig, “A Devil In Every Bottle.”

The Mahones do bartenders everywhere a favor by including the song “Last Call At The Bar” on the album. Finny reflects “It’ is a song that bartenders can relate to – that feeling you get when you tell everybody to bug off and go home. It’s a fun song that sticks in your head, and it fits the Jameson Street theme.” The good times on Jameson Street don’t stop at drinking songs, though. The album runs the gamut from toe-tapping instrumentals to heartfelt love songs to a cover of a Pogues classic, “If I Should Fall From The Grace Of God.”

The album features previous colleagues and long-time friends including Dave Barton (The Peelers), Nicholas Smyth (The Dreadnoughts), Glenn Milchem (Blue Rodeo), and Stuart Cameron (Crash Test Dummies). There are also a handful of co-writers including Barton, Greg Norton, Owen Warnica, Paddy Concanon, and Jonathon Moorman.

Forming on St. Patrick’s Day in 1990 The Mahones have been working on their own brand of Irish punk ever since. The group consists of Dublin-born Finny McConnel (Lead Vocals, Guitar, Songwriter), Sean Riot Ryan (Bass, Vocals), Michael O’Grady (Tin Whistle, Accordion, Vocals), and newest member Nicole Kaiser (Accordion, Vocals). The Mahones have released 12 studio albums, three compilation albums, two live albums, and two EPs. Their song, “Paint the Town Red” was featured in the climactic final fight scene of the 2 Time Academy Award-winning film The Fighter. Alongside this, their music has been featured in Ecstasy, Dog Park, Celtic Pride, ABC’s Castle, and Lost Girl.

The Mahones were the 2020 winner of Paddy Rock Radios’ Top 5 Albums of the decade, winner of Shite N Onions 2015 Best Album award, and Punk.ie’s 2014 Best Celtic Punk Album. The band has toured through 35 countries internationally, headlined festivals all over the world.

 

Siouxsie And The Banshees ‘All Souls’ Classics & Rarities LP Released October 21

0

ALL SOULS, the new collection of Siouxsie And The Banshees tracks personally curated by Siouxsie Sioux, which collates classic tracks and rarities into an Autumnal celebration, will be released on October 21.

Siouxsie And The Banshees were undoubtedly one of the most influential, fearless, and uncompromising bands to come from the punk era and this selection clearly illustrates their varied and unique musical approach. ALL SOULS opens with 1982’s ”Fireworks” which is one of three iconic singles featured here alongside ”Spellbound” (recently used to end Stranger Things Season 4) and closes with the mesmerising ”Peek-A-Boo.” Also included is ”Halloween” from the band’s classic Juju album mixed with more idiosyncratic tracks such as ”El Dia De Los Muertos,” a B-side from the ”Last Beat Of My Heart” single, ”Something Wicked (This Way Comes) ” from the single of ”The Killing Jar” and ”Supernatural Thing” from 1981’s ”Arabian Knights” single all of which are making their first appearance on vinyl in decades.

All the tracks have been re-mastered at Abbey Road studios with Siouxsie overseeing the process and cut at half-speed by Miles Showell. The record will be released on both 180g black and an exclusive limited edition orange vinyl as well as digitally.

The collection features new and unique artwork directed by Siouxsie featuring a marigold; the symbolic flower of the Mexican Day of the Dead/All Souls Day festivities.

L7’s Bricks Are Heavy North American Fall Tour Kicks Off Oct 3

0

The legends are back! L7 have invited fans to join them in celebrating the 30th anniversary of their breakthrough third album Bricks Are Heavy originally released on April 14, 1992. An electrifying North American fall tour kicks off Oct 3 when, for the first time ever, they will perform this seminal record front to back including fan favorite “Shitlist” famously featured in Natural Born Killers. To help celebrate, they are adding special guest support acts to join them throughout the run including: Downtown Boys, Fea, The Side Eyes, Radkey, Vera Bloom, OMAT and The Black Halos.

Alongside the tour, the Bricks Are Heavy 30th anniversary reissue is set to be released September 30 on Licorice Pizza Records. Originally debuting at #1 on the Billboard Heatseekers chart and produced by Butch Vig (Nirvana, Garbage, Smashing Pumpkins), this special anniversary edition will include all 11 tracks digitally remastered by Howie Weinberg (Ramones, Pixies, Metallica) and available with special packaged gold and black vinyl.

As the band’s vocalist/guitarist Donita Sparks states, “ I mean, we thought the record was close to “going Gold” 30 years ago,… but honestly we have no idea. We have yet to receive an official accounting.” Never a band to be hung up on rules, regulations or facts, Donita continues, “ to hell with it, we’re certifying the record “Gold” ourselves and making gold vinyl for the reissue. Get ‘em while they’re hot, before we’re sued by the RIAA.”

The Police ‘Ghost In The Machine’ Limited Edition Picture Disc LP To Be Released On November 4

0

Ghost In The Machine, The Police’s fourth album which was first released in 1981, is to be reissued as a stunning limited edition picture disc, featuring the alternate, ‘original’ track-listing and sequencing.

To be released on November 4 and now available on pre-order, this special reissue features three additional tracks not included on the original album – “I Burn For You” – the single mix of the track from the “Brimstone and Treacle” album – “Once Upon A Daydream” and “Shambelle.”

To add to the unique nature of this release, and reflecting the personality of the band, four songs (“Spirits In The Material World,“ “Rehumanize Yourself,“ “One World (Not Three)“ and “Hungry For You“) feature Stewart Copeland counting in the tracks – distinctive audio from the recording studio that was not included on the 1981 release.

The discs’ side A design features the logo image from the front sleeve and side B features the inner sleeve image (see below).

Recorded at AIR Studios, Montserrat and Le Studio, Quebec, Ghost In The Machine was No. 1 on the U.K. album chart, No. 2 on the Billboard 200, and a multi-platinum best seller all over the world in which the bands’ jazz influences became more pronounced but still retained the sophisticated pop appeal for which the band had become known.

The original release featured three hit singles – “Every Little Thing She Does Is Magic,“ “Invisible Sun“ and “Spirits in the Material World.“ Other highlights also include the rollicking “Demolition Man“ (later covered by Grace Jones), the frantic “Rehumanize Yourself,“ and the ballads “Secret Journey“ and “Darkness.“

Dave Matthews Band Announces Fall 2022 North American Tour

0

Dave Matthews Band announced a fall 2022 North American tour, which will launch on November 2 at Rogers Arena in Vancouver, BC – the first of three Pacific Northwest dates. The headline run, which will include shows at Target Center in Minneapolis (November 13) and Chicago’s United Center (November 15), will conclude the weekend before Thanksgiving with a two-night stand at Madison Square Garden in New York City (November 18 & 19).

Tickets will go on sale to the general public on Friday, September 23, at 10:00 a.m. local time.

Sunday night, Dave Matthews Band wrapped up its traditional Labor Day weekend celebration at the scenic Gorge Amphitheatre in George, WA. The band’s summer tour will continue this weekend with two shows at Fiddler’s Green Amphitheatre in Greenwood Village, CO (September 9 & 10) and wrap up with a two-night stand at the Hollywood Bowl in Los Angeles (September 19 & 20).

With the 2022 tour, Dave Matthews Band will have funded the planting of an additional one million trees, bringing the total amount of trees funded to 3 million. DMB is proud to partner with The Nature Conservancy’s Plant a Billion Trees program, a global forest restoration effort. Fans are invited to join the band, The Dreaming Tree Wines, DocuSign and other tour partners to help regreen our planet. For more information, visit dmbtrees.org.

Dave Matthews Band has sold more than 25 million tickets since its inception and a collective 38 million CDs and DVDs combined. With the release of 2018’s Come Tomorrow, Dave Matthews Band became the first group in history to have seven consecutive studio albums debut at No. 1 on the Billboard 200.

John Legend to Perform for SiriusXM in Los Angeles

0

SiriusXM announced today that John Legend will play a special invitation-only concert as part of SiriusXM’s Small Stage Series presented by American Express. The intimate performance for SiriusXM subscribers will take place at El Rey Theatre in Los Angeles on Wednesday, September 28.

The special concert will feature John Legend performing some of his biggest hits as well as music from his upcoming album Legend, which is scheduled to be released on Friday, September 9.

“I’m so excited to perform music from my new album LEGEND for SiriusXM’s Small Stage Series. I’ve been looking forward to performing these songs live and can’t wait to share a special night of music with friends and fans at the El Rey in Los Angeles,” said John Legend.

John Legend’s Small Stage Series concert will air on Wednesday, October 5 at 6:00 pm ET/PT on The Pulse (ch. 5), at 8:00 pm ET/PT on Heart & Soul (ch. 48) and on the SXM App. Additionally, select songs from the show will air across multiple SiriusXM music channels including SiriusXM Hits 1, The Heat, SiriusXM FLY, Pandora NOW, and 10s Spot.

Maren Morris Raises Over $150k For GLAAD And Trans Lifeline With “Lunatic” T-Shirt

0

GLAAD, the world’s largest l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ender, and queer (LGBTQ) media advocacy organization, today shared that Grammy award winning country music singer and songwriter Maren Morris has raised over $150K to date for GLAAD’s Transgender Media Program and Trans Lifeline with the “Lunatic” T-shirt launched last week.

In response to Tucker Carlson calling Maren Morris a “Lunatic Country Music Person” over defending trans youth, the country singer teamed up with @LAAD and Trans Lifeline to create a ‘Lunatic Country Music Person’ and the Peer Support & Crisis Hotline for trans youth: 877-565-8860 black tee.

“By publicly speaking out to support trans youth, country music superstar, Maren Morris is connecting with an audience who may be less familiar with the transgender community and the current wave of attacks on their rights. Not only is she using her platform and influence to help further the conversation and likely change hearts and minds, she is raising crucial funds which will go directly into GLAAD and Trans Lifeline’s work to support the trans community at a time when it’s needed more than ever,” said GLAAD Vice President of Communications & Talent, Anthony Allen Ramos.

“The way that transgender people are talked about on social media, especially by celebrities, has an impact on the wellbeing of trans folks, who already live in a society that does not want them to exist. Social marginalization and stigma cause us to have a significantly harder time accessing community support, safe housing, gainful employment, and affordable healthcare, which push many people in our community toward crisis. We are grateful to Maren Morris for not only calling out transphobia but also using her platform to support Trans Lifeline as we answer calls every day from trans people in crisis,” says Lauren Gray, Trans Lifeline’s Director of Advancement.

Trans Lifeline is the largest direct service nonprofit to trans people in North America, connecting trans people to the community, resources, and support they need to survive and thrive. Trans Lifeline’s hotline cares for trans people in the U.S. and Canada through moments of crisis and suicidality; their microgrants program provides low-barrier grants to trans people in need of legal name changes and updated government IDs, as well as specialized support for trans people who are incarcerated or undocumented; their advocacy program runs the #SafeHotlines campaign to ensure safety, transparency, and agency on crisis hotlines. Trans Lifeline envisions a world where trans people have the connection, economic security, and care everyone needs and deserves – free of prisons and police.
